Transaction 59015743b2854645880dc0b104ff681c3218d6cee0c5261d9c825a0adeff2fde
1 Input
1 Output
-
59015743b2854645880dc0b104ff681c3218d6cee0c5261d9c825a0adeff2fde:0
- value
- 2347889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1231e3cc252f8af6eecdcbf9dba4170655ab3738 OP_EQUAL
- address
- 33MDrQLMS1it5711SnFU3JBgVMQyYYFCbs